Enterprise Resource Planning (Erp) Database Template

Centralize users, products, orders, and expenses in one unified system.

Categories

Database
ERP
CRM
Inventory Management
Internal tool
Business Ops/Finance

Summarize with AI

Overview

This ERP system serves as a central nervous system for your business, consolidating users, inventory, sales, and financial tracking into a single source of truth. It replaces disconnected silos with a structured environment where every asset, employee, and transaction is accurately accounted for and easily accessible.

The database connects five core tables—Users, Products, Customers, Orders, and Expenses—to create a dynamic operational map. Orders automatically link to specific customers and products to calculate totals, while expenses are tied directly to team members for accountability. This relational structure ensures data remains consistent across departments without manual updates.

Why use this ERP database instead of spreadsheets

The power of Softr Databases

Spreadsheets struggle with the complex interconnections required for resource planning, often relying on fragile VLOOKUPs that break as your data scales. Softr Databases handle these relationships natively, allowing you to link Orders to Customers or Expenses to Users without data duplication. This "one table = one object" approach ensures strict data integrity, supports powerful Rollup fields to sum revenue automatically, and eliminates the chaos of mixed data types.

Core features and functionality

This template includes pre-built formulas for generating unique IDs (like "ORD-123") and enforced field types for currencies, dates, and attachments to keep records standardized. You can further automate operations by adding Database AI agents to categorize new line items or summarize order details automatically, reducing the manual administrative burden on your team.

Tables for Enterprise Resource Planning (Erp) Database

  • Users

    Manage employee profiles, contact info, and internal team assignments

  • Products

    Maintain inventory with stock monitoring, pricing, and classifications

  • Customers

    Store client company records, contact details, and total revenue data

  • Orders

    Track sales transactions, processing statuses, and historical invoices

  • Expenses

    Monitor corporate spending across various categories linked to staff

Who is this ERP database for

This template is designed for growing SMBs and operational teams needing a unified view of their resources.

  • Operations Managers: Track product inventory levels, stock values, and supply chain logistics in real time.
  • Finance Teams: Monitor company expenses across departments and reconcile invoices faster with clear categorization.
  • Sales Leaders: Manage customer details, track revenue rollups, and monitor order status from entry to delivery.
  • HR Departments: Maintain detailed employee records, including contract types and assigned equipment like laptops.

How to take it further

Customize the database
Adapt the system to your specific workflows by modifying the choice values in the "Team" or "Expense Category" columns. You can easily add new fields to track specific metrics like shipping providers, employee performance reviews, or vendor contract details.

Import your existing data
Migrate from legacy tools quickly by importing your existing customer lists, product catalogs, and employee directories via CSV. This populates your tables immediately so you can start managing live data and connecting records on day one.

Build an app on top
Turn this database into a secure internal portal using the interface builder. You can give employees restricted access to submit their own expenses or view their assigned equipment using granular users and permissions settings, ensuring sensitive financial data remains visible only to admins and management.

How to use the Enterprise Resource Planning (Erp) Database template

  • 1
    Click Use template: Sign up or log in to your Softr account (it’s free, no credit card required!)
  • 2
    Fine-tune the database: Adjust fields, options, and , settings so the database matches your specific needs. You can rename fields, change select options, or modify default values.
  • 3
    Add your data: Replace the mock content with your own and information. You can add data manually or import it quickly o cr via CSV.
  • 4
    Build an app on top of your database: Create a Softr app on top of this database to have a custom interface where users can log in, view data, and collaborate.

Frequently asked questions

  • What is an ERP database?
  • Why use a no-code database to build an ERP system?
  • How can AI help managing data for ERP?
  • Can I build an app with this ERP database?
  • Is this ERP template free?
  • How is this different from managing ERP in Excel?

Build your custom Enterprise Resource Planning (Erp) Database today.

Build and launch your first app in under 30 minutes.